What Are Passenger Lifts for Vehicles?
Passenger lifts are hydraulic lifting platforms installed in vehicles to assist passengers, particularly wheelchair users, in getting in and out safely. They are typically fitted at the rear or side doors of vans and minibuses, allowing easy access without the need for manual lifting.
These lifts operate using a hydraulic system that raises and lowers a platform between ground level and the vehicle floor. The process is usually fully automated, with controls operated via a remote, control panel, or even a mobile device. This ensures smooth and consistent movement with minimal effort from the operator.
Passenger lifts are widely used in sectors such as healthcare, education, emergency services, and transport fleets. Their ability to reduce physical strain while improving accessibility makes them a valuable addition to any vehicle designed for passenger transport.
How Do Passenger Lifts Work?
Passenger lifts rely on hydraulic systems that use pressurised fluid to create controlled lifting motion. This allows the platform to move up and down steadily, even when carrying significant weight. Most systems are designed to handle loads of around 350 kg, making them suitable for wheelchairs and occupants.
The operation is straightforward. The platform unfolds, lowers to the ground, allows the passenger to position themselves securely, and then lifts them to the vehicle floor. Once inside, the platform can be folded and stored neatly, ensuring it does not obstruct the interior space.
Safety is a key part of how these lifts function. Features such as anti-slip platforms, automatic roll stops, warning sounds, and self-locking mechanisms ensure that both passengers and operators are protected throughout the process.
Key Features of Modern Passenger Lifts
Modern passenger lifts are designed to deliver safety, efficiency, and ease of use in demanding environments. They incorporate advanced engineering and durable materials to ensure reliable performance across various applications, from healthcare transport to commercial fleets.
- Hydraulic systems for smooth and stable lifting
- Fully automatic lifting, lowering, and folding functions
- Anti-skid platforms for enhanced safety
- Automatic roll stops and self-locking mechanisms
- Wired remote control and optional mobile operation
- Manual backup systems for emergencies
- Handrails for added passenger support
- Corrosion-resistant materials for durability
These features work together to create a seamless user experience. Automation reduces the effort required from operators, while safety mechanisms ensure that passengers remain secure throughout the lifting process. The inclusion of manual backup systems also ensures that the lift remains functional even in the event of power failure.
Durability is equally important, especially in South Africa’s varied climate conditions. High-quality finishes, such as stainless steel components and protective coatings, help prevent corrosion and extend the lifespan of the lift. This makes modern passenger lifts a long-term investment for any transport operation.

Types of Passenger Lifts Available
There are several types of passenger lifts designed to suit different vehicle configurations and needs. Vertical platform lifts, including split or whole-platform designs, are commonly used for minibuses and larger vehicles, offering stable and secure lifting.
Internal tail lift designs with folding platforms are ideal for van conversions. These lifts maximise interior space while still providing full functionality, making them a practical option for smaller vehicles or specialised transport applications.
Compact tail lifts designed for small commercial vehicles and cars provide a flexible solution for lighter-duty use. Each type is tailored to specific requirements, ensuring that businesses can find a lift that matches their operational needs.

Safety and Maintenance of Passenger Lifts
Safety should always be a top priority when using passenger lifts. Operators must ensure that weight limits are not exceeded and that passengers are positioned securely on the platform before operation begins.
Regular inspections are essential to maintain performance and safety. Checking hydraulic systems, moving parts, and safety features such as sensors and emergency stops helps prevent unexpected failures and ensures reliable operation.
Routine maintenance, including lubrication and timely repairs, extends the lifespan of the lift. A well-maintained system not only improves safety but also reduces long-term costs by avoiding major breakdowns and downtime.
